To use SystmOne - patient electronic system to manage tasks and ensure accurate electronic patient records are maintained. This will include scanning documents and booking patients onto clinical rotas - training will be given and the level of using SystmOne will be commensurate to your role
Be aware in the CDC environment of volatile situations and how to manage in the confines of your role and how to escalate
Providing a comprehensive and efficient Secretarial/Administration service for Child Development Centre medical/clinical staff. This involves audio typing of medical letters, statutory medical and clinical reports, documents, forms, witness statements and other correspondence as required which includes using medical terminology.
This will include confidential child protection reports within required timescales, with accuracy. Ensuring a timely dispatch of outgoing post.
To produce and check correspondence and medical reports that are visually attractive and of a high standard of readability using Microsoft Office
To book clinics for new referrals, follow up appointments and joint multi-disciplinary assessments, and ensure that complete and up to date medical notes are available for each patient if required
Ensure follow up appointments are recorded via patient electronic system (SystmOne) within the timeframes dictated by statutory guidelines
Deal with correspondence and telephone queries for medical/clinical staff as required, maintaining efficient records are recorded appropriately via patient electronic system (SystmOne)
To undertake task management on the patient electronic system (SystmOne) as required
liaise with the Centre Co-ordinator/Clinical Services Manager regarding complaints and queries received by phone or electronically
You will be required to take notes/minutes at local team meetings and transcribe them
Collate and present data/information as requested, using agreed systems and formats
To participate in supporting service development for the Child Development Centre Service
